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12658 9041960954 0533843 239558901 4925930
348520443 40
348520443 40
614220095 51 923 726563 76
All about undefined
Interested in learning more?
348520443 40
614220095 51 923 726563 76
See more
691727 9983064860 07877626
5837 015650 2328 61
See more
34002 904491
427 66165828 8718972025 41580598
See more